WebHow to convert binary to decimal For binary number with n digits: dn-1 ... d3 d2 d1 d0 The decimal number is equal to the sum of binary digits (d n) times their power of 2 (2 n ): decimal = d0 ×2 0 + d1 ×2 1 + d2 ×2 2 + ... Example Find the decimal value of 111001 2: 111001 2 = 1⋅2 5 +1⋅2 4 +1⋅2 3 +0⋅2 2 +0⋅2 1 +1⋅2 0 = 57 10 sims 4 black outline cc https://highriselonesome.com

WebBinary to Decimal conversion How to convert decimal to binary Conversion steps: Divide the number by 2. Get the integer quotient for the next iteration. Get the remainder for the binary digit. Repeat the steps until the quotient is equal to 0. WebJul 7, 2009 · We do it by adding an extra symbol. For example, a line over the digits that repeat in the decimal expansion of the number. What we need to represent decimal numbers as a sequence of binary numbers are 1) a sequence of binary numbers, 2) a radix point, and 3) some other symbol to indicate the repeating part of the sequence.

WebMar 24, 2024 · The decimal expansion of a number is its representation in base-10 (i.e., in the decimal system). In this system, each "decimal place" consists of a digit 0-9 arranged such that each digit is multiplied by a power of 10, decreasing from left to right, and with a decimal place indicating the 10^0=1s place.
